What is Brandpad
Brandpad is a brand guidelines and asset management platform used to centralize brand standards, design components, and approved marketing materials in a shareable, web-based hub. It supports marketing and brand teams that need to distribute up-to-date logos, colors, typography, templates, and usage rules to internal teams and external partners. The product focuses on structured brand documentation and controlled access to assets rather than social publishing or employee-sharing workflows. It is typically used to reduce off-brand content by making approved resources easy to find and reuse.
Centralized brand guidelines hub
Brandpad consolidates brand rules, visual identity guidance, and supporting examples into a single online destination. This helps teams replace static PDFs and scattered files with a controlled, versioned source of truth. It is well-suited for sharing brand standards with agencies, partners, and distributed teams. The focus on documentation aligns more with design-system and brand-governance needs than with social advocacy tooling.
Structured asset distribution
The platform is designed to package and distribute approved brand assets (for example, logo files and templates) alongside usage guidance. This reduces ambiguity by pairing files with rules and examples in the same place. It supports common brand operations use cases such as onboarding new teams and enabling partners. Compared with advocacy platforms, the emphasis is on asset correctness rather than content amplification.
External sharing and access control
Brandpad is commonly implemented as a shareable portal that can be accessed by internal users and external stakeholders. This supports controlled dissemination of brand materials without emailing files or granting broad drive access. It can improve governance by limiting what is available and by keeping materials current. This is a different strength profile than tools optimized for employee social sharing and engagement tracking.
Limited employee advocacy workflows
Brandpad is not primarily built for employee advocacy programs such as suggested post feeds, one-click social sharing, or advocacy leaderboards. Organizations running structured advocacy initiatives may need a dedicated advocacy platform for distribution and participation management. As a result, it may not replace tools that focus on activating employees on social networks. It fits better as a brand resource layer than as an advocacy execution system.
Not a demand gen execution suite
The product does not present as a full demand generation system for campaign orchestration, lead capture, scoring, or marketing automation. Teams typically still require separate systems for email, paid media, landing pages, and CRM integration. Brandpad can support demand gen indirectly by providing approved assets and messaging. However, it is not positioned as the system of record for pipeline-oriented marketing operations.
Design system depth may vary
While it supports brand standards and reusable assets, it may not cover advanced design-system engineering needs such as component code repositories, developer tooling integrations, or automated design-to-code workflows. Product teams building complex UI libraries may require additional tools to manage code-level components and releases. The platform is strongest for brand governance and marketing-facing guidelines. Fit depends on whether the organization needs a marketing brand hub or a full product design system lifecycle tool.
Plan & Pricing
| Plan | Price | Key features & notes |
|---|---|---|
| Brand | $50 per month or $500 per year | 2 brands, unlimited editors, unlimited account user invites; access to all features during trial; billed monthly or annually. |
| Portfolio | $125 per month or $1,250 per year | 6 brands, unlimited editors, unlimited account user invites; billed monthly or annually. |
| Enterprise (Papirfly) | Custom pricing | Enterprise offering via Papirfly (parent company); contact sales for details. |
